n September 2019, Elim Sound, in partnership with Elim Missions, sent four of our worship team members out to Nairobi, Kenya, for a week of serving and teaching.

Cluny Wiecki, Daniel Scott and Joel Hampton, together with Pastor Sam Blake and Ian Yates from Elim Sound, began the week at the African Pastors’ Conference, where men and women in church leadership from all over Africa came to receive encouragement and inspiration. Following this, the team spent two days training musicians, singers and technical engineers on subjects such as: the heart of a worshipper; forging a successful song list, and individual instruments. To round off a great week, they led worship at City Lighters Church, a youth church that has grown to over 400 within two years! Here’s what the team had to say about their experience…
